Intellij Idea Intellij项目结构和Maven版本之间的JDK版本不匹配

r1zk6ea1  于 12个月前  发布在  Maven
关注(0)|答案(2)|浏览(143)

在Intellij的项目结构中,JDK版本选择为1.8
在Maven属性中,JDK版本也被提到为1.8

  • 但仍然在mvn --install不知何故,我得到的JDK版本为11*

无法理解这种行为。我如何使它成为1.8
项目截图


的数据

d7v8vwbk

d7v8vwbk1#

关于您的个人配置:
通过在终端中构建:你应该得到一个java 8 jar,因为你要求java 8作为目标,带有jdk 11(这是兼容的)
通过在Intellij IDEA中构建:你应该得到一个Java 8 jar,因为你要求Java 8作为目标,以JDK 8作为项目结构。

pgvzfuti

pgvzfuti2#

尝试并更改设置->构建,执行,部署->构建工具-> Maven -> Runner -> JRE以使用JDK 8或甚至更好地将JAVA_HOME设置为JDK 8

相关问题